3. Abandonment options
Albert Co. is considering a four-year project that will require an initial investment of $15,000. The base-case cash flows for this project are projected to be $14,000 per year. The best-case cash flows are projected to be $21,000 per year, and the worst-case cash flows are projected to be $2,500 per year. The companys analysts have estimated that there is a 50% probability that the project will generate the base-case cash flows. The analysts also think that there is a 25% probability of the project generating the best-case cash flows and a 25% probability of the project generating the worst-case cash flows.
What would be the expected net present value (NPV) of this project if the projects cost of capital is 11%?
$23,173
$22,119
$16,853
$21,066
Albert now wants to take into account its ability to abandon the project at the end of year 2 if the project ends up generating the worst-case scenario cash flows. If it decides to abandon the project at the end of year 2, the company will receive a one-time net cash inflow of $4,500(at the end of year 2). The $4,500 the company receives at the end of year 2 is the difference between the cash the company receives from selling off the projects assets and the companys $2,500 cash outflow from operations. Additionally, if it abandons the project, the company will have no cash flows in years 3 and 4 of the project.
Using the information in the preceding problem, find the expected NPV of this project when taking the abandonment option into account.
$28,026
$21,020
$23,355
$26,858
What is the value of the option to abandon the project?
